Slam Jam Announces Official Release Info For The Nike Blazer Mid “Class ’77”

Among the many collaborations released throughout the year, it seems retailers have more frequently taken the charge, rivaling designers such as Chitose Abe and Jun Takahashi or artists like Travis Scott in design alone. Branching out throughout all facets of fashion retail, Nike has only recently enlisted the Italy-based Slam Jam whose work with the Blazer Mid has put them on the map in terms of the public eye. Releasing an extremely exclusive New Balance 990v3 just a few weeks prior, the imprint has not slowed down one bit since their inaugural sneaker years ago and November is set to maintain that momentum as it receives a follow up to the aforementioned basketball silhouette though now in an inverted colorway. Where its precursor laid out white, this pair dons black, utilizing a fabrication assortment of both canvas and leather. Contrasting shades at the upside-down are certainly the most notable but the “Class ’77” type at the heel is certainly an equally noteworthy detail. Grab a good look at their upcoming entry right below and expect a release to go down first on slamjam.com come November 9th with a following in-store raffle on November 21st; a small Nike SNKRS release will then follow likely on their official November 29th release date.

Slam Jam x Nike Blazer Mid “Class ’77”
Online Release Date: November 9th, 2019
In-Store Raffle Date: November 21st, 2019
Official Release Date: November 29th, 2019
